The Impact of Antibiotic Therapy Options and Multidisciplinary Approach in Prosthetic Joint Infections
João Lucas1,2, José Queirós3, Daniel Soares2,4
1Orthopaedic and Traumatology Department, ULS do Alto Ave, 4835-044 Guimarães, Portugal.
Optimizing antibiotic strategies and multidisciplinary team (MDT) involvement significantly improves outcomes for periprosthetic joint infection (PJI) patients. Rifampicin-based treatments and MDT care, especially for debridement, antibiotics, and implant retention (DAIR), are key to successful infection-free survival.

Background:
- Periprosthetic joint infection (PJI) is a major challenge in arthroplasty.
- Optimal antibiotic strategies and the role of multidisciplinary teams (MDT) in PJI management require further definition.
Purpose of the Study:
- To evaluate the impact of different antibiotic regimens and treatment team structures on PJI outcomes.
- To identify predictors of success in PJI management.
Main Methods:
- Retrospective analysis of 86 PJI surgical procedures (2017-2023).
- Data collected on clinical factors, microbiology, surgical strategy (DAIR, one-stage, two-stage), and antibiotic regimens.
- Outcomes compared across antibiotic classes and treatment teams (orthopaedics alone, orthopaedics with MDT, dedicated MDT).
Main Results:
- Rifampicin-based regimens showed higher cure rates than non-anti-biofilm therapies.
- Flucloxacillin plus rifampicin demonstrated comparable outcomes to rifampicin-fluoroquinolone combinations.
- MDT involvement was the strongest predictor of success, particularly in DAIR procedures (100% cure with MDT vs. 48% with orthopaedics alone, p=0.025).
Conclusions:
- Rifampicin-based therapy and flucloxacillin are effective for staphylococcal PJI.
- Multidisciplinary team management, especially for DAIR procedures, significantly improves PJI treatment outcomes.
- Structured MDT care pathways combined with optimized antibiotic strategies are crucial for successful PJI management.
